1. Construction Cost Card Purpose
The cost card explains all the costs expected during the lifecycle of the project. This includes design costs, material costs, work, overhead costs, and final amounts.
These cards provide project owners and contractors with the research they need to allocate funds appropriately and avoid financial risks. They not only incur direct costs, but also make decisions.
2. Where estimates begin: early stages
Estimates begin before the final design is complete. During the concept or feasibility stage, a total number is generated to assess whether the project will continue.

5. Keep estimation flexible during design changes
The design develops. Changes occur. Materials are unavailable, or customers are looking for new surfaces. These changes will affect pricing, and estimates should reflect this.
The professional team regularly updates its cost cards to ensure the project stays up to date if they make new selections.
6. Risk allowance and unforeseen circumstances
The estimate will not be completed without unexpected plans. Weather, delays, or material shortages can affect all budgets.

9. Loop Closure: Final Adjustment
After completing the build, you can compare the estimated costs with actual costs to learn and improve your team.
